In today's world, transportation plays a crucial role in our daily lives. One of the most common methods of transportation is the use of vehicles. However, these vehicles need to be powered in order to function effectively. This brings us to the concept of fueling vehicle (燃料车辆). The process of fueling vehicle involves providing the necessary energy source to keep them operational. Traditionally, this has been done using fossil fuels such as gasoline and diesel. However, with the growing concerns about climate change and environmental degradation, there has been a shift towards more sustainable alternatives.The significance of fueling vehicle cannot be overstated. Without proper fueling, vehicles would not be able to operate, leading to disruptions in transportation and logistics. This would have a cascading effect on economies, as goods and services rely heavily on the movement of vehicles. For instance, delivery trucks that are unable to refuel would cause delays in shipments, affecting businesses and consumers alike.Moreover, the way we fuel our vehicles has evolved over the years. Electric vehicles (EVs) have gained immense popularity due to their reduced carbon footprint. The process of fueling vehicle in this context refers to charging the batteries of EVs instead of filling up a gas tank. Charging stations are becoming more widespread, making it easier for individuals to transition from traditional vehicles to electric ones. This shift not only helps in reducing greenhouse gas emissions but also promotes energy independence.Another important aspect of fueling vehicle is the innovation surrounding biofuels. Biofuels are derived from organic materials and can serve as a renewable alternative to fossil fuels. The process of fueling vehicle with biofuels can significantly lower the carbon emissions associated with traditional fuels. For example, biodiesel, made from vegetable oils or animal fats, can be used in diesel engines with little to no modification. This presents a viable option for those looking to reduce their environmental impact while still utilizing existing vehicle technology.In addition to these advancements, there is also a growing interest in hydrogen fuel cells. The process of fueling vehicle with hydrogen involves converting hydrogen gas into electricity to power the vehicle. This method produces only water vapor as a byproduct, making it an incredibly clean energy source. Companies around the world are investing in research and development to make hydrogen-powered vehicles more accessible and efficient.Furthermore, public awareness regarding the importance of fueling vehicle sustainably is increasing. Governments are implementing policies to encourage the use of cleaner fuels and incentivize consumers to adopt greener technologies. This includes tax breaks for electric vehicle purchases, grants for installing charging stations, and funding for research into alternative fuels. As a result, consumers are becoming more informed about their choices and the impact of their decisions on the environment.In conclusion, the concept of fueling vehicle (燃料车辆) is evolving rapidly as we strive for a more sustainable future. The transition from traditional fossil fuels to electric, biofuels, and hydrogen options represents a significant shift in how we think about transportation. As individuals and societies, it is imperative that we embrace these changes to ensure a healthier planet for future generations. By understanding the importance of fueling vehicle responsibly, we can contribute to a cleaner and more sustainable world.
